Q: My plugin's spans aren't showing in TraceWeave. Why?

A: Plugins must propagate the trace context header on every outbound call. Dropped headers break the chain. Test against the sandbox collector first. Sandbox access requires the plugin-author recovery credential; if your session resets, re-authenticate with it. The current recovery passphrase is:

vault phrase of tajef-tafog = istox-sorax-zorox-casok-holox-kelix-weneth-drueth-casion

Subject: FY Headcount Plan — First Pass

Hi all,

Quick heads-up before Thursday's session: the draft headcount plan for next year is ready. We're proposing 14 net adds across Varnell Systems, weighted toward the Ostwick engineering hub, with backfills frozen in support roles until Q2. Finance has modeled three scenarios; the middle case keeps payroll growth under 6%. Marta will walk the exec team through the sensitivity tables. Before you review, note the confidential planning assumption below that frames the whole exercise.

internal memo for yahag-tahog: The pricing group signed off on a budget of $152.8 million for Project Soriel.

## Shuttle-Bus Gate — Pellmarsh Campus

The shuttle bus from Dunnock Station enters via the east gate. New starters should board at the marked stop and scan in on arrival at the gatehouse. The gate barrier opens automatically for the bus; pedestrians use the side turnstile with the code below.

door code, yagap-bahof: bdg-O-05